Fork CMS Iphone app

844 views
752 views

Published on

The presentation that was given on the 3.5 release party (21/03/2013)

Published in: Technology
0 Comments
2 Likes
Statistics
Notes
  • Be the first to comment

No Downloads
Views
Total views
844
On SlideShare
0
From Embeds
0
Number of Embeds
15
Actions
Shares
0
Downloads
2
Comments
0
Likes
2
Embeds 0
No embeds

No notes for slide

Fork CMS Iphone app

  1. 1. Hi! I’m TijsHallo, ik ben Tijs.Een PHP developer en ook wel bezig met Fork.
  2. 2. I work with these guysSamen met Jan en Jens hebben we 2.5 jaar geleden SumoCodersopgericht.Ondertussen zijn Sam, Niels, Mathias en Jonas (sinds maandag)erbijgekomen.Voor onze websites gebruiken we als basis Fork CMS. En eigenlijk zijnwe er vrij zeker van dat Fork CMS het beste CMS is.
  3. 3. We love Fork CMS
  4. 4. Maar... op Iphone is het al een pak minderBut on mobile...Muh, not that good
  5. 5. There’s an app for that Also, credits to Peter-Jan Brone!De app is bedoeld voor mensen die willen weten hoe hun site bezig isvan op ieder mogelijke locatie. Denk aan CEO’s met een cijferfetish diein de file staat, maar evengoed aan Bakker Mark die gebruik maaktvan de formbuilder voor zijn bestelling van belegde broodjes.De app is onderverdeeld in 3 onderdelen:- Statistieken- (Blog)Comments- FormBuilder
  6. 6. Statistics • Visitors • Keywords • ReferrersVia dit simplistische dashboard kan je zien hoeveel bezoekers er opde site waren, hoeveel unieke bezoekers en hoeveel nieuwe.Daarnaast kan je de top keywords en de top referers zien.Ideaal voor de cijfer-fetish-CEO
  7. 7. Comments • Push notifications • ModerationReacties op blogberichten.Iedere keer er een nieuwe reactie is (met uitzondering van spam)krijg je een push-notification.Je kan dan de reactie gaan ver wijderen, markeren als spam ofmodereren indien nodig.
  8. 8. Formbuilder • Push notifications • All formsNet als bij de reacties krijg je voor iedere inzending eenpushnotification.Je kan dan doorklikken naar de detailweergave van de inzending,waar je alle velden te zien krijgt.Het leuke is dat het voor alle formulieren gemaakt met de formbuilderwerkt.
  9. 9. How does it work?Leuk zo app, maar hoe werkt dat spel?
  10. 10. CommunicationDe data komt uit Fork, dus op een of andere manier moet die dataopgehaald worden.Applicatie maakt per scherm connectie met de API van jouw website,rechtstreeks. your siteDaarvoor is de (bestaande) API uitgebreid met extra methods.Dit is dus meteen ook de reden waarom gebruikers het vinkje “API-access” moeten aanvinken vooraleer ze kunnen gebruik maken vande appDoordat er via de API gewerkt wordt kan er morgen misschien wel eenAndroid app zijn, of een native app, of ... the app
  11. 11. Communication Voor wie nieuwsgierig is: /api/1.0/client toont je alle mogelijke calls Ook jouw calls komen daarbij: enkel maar api.php aanmaken en je methods public zetten.
  12. 12. PushLeukste feature, of toch die waar mensen het meest van zullengenieten: push notifications
  13. 13. PushJust a single line of code,or not Betrekkelijk weinig code nodig om een pushnotification uit te sturen. Je kan dat in je eigen CMS gebruiken, door ipv een key gewoon een string tekst door te sturen. Wel beperkt in bytesize.
  14. 14. Pushyour site apple api.fork -cms.co m api.fork-cms.com is nodig, anders zou er per site een app nodig zijn the app wel éénrichtingverkeer: sites naar api.fork-cms.com, omgekeerd niet mogelijk (uiteraard wel response)
  15. 15. Now available, for free forkcmsapp.com
  16. 16. if (!$Questions? ) { $me->drink(‘beer’);} forkcmsapp.com
  17. 17. http://forkcmsapp.com

×